The National Ethnic Coalition of Organizations (NECO), through its coveted Ellis Island Medal of Honor award, each year acknowledges the important contributions of some very special people.

Nasser J. Kazeminy, NECO Co-Chair writes, "NECO has for over twenty years celebrated the diversity that comprises our unique American mosaic. Our Ellis Island Medals of Honor recognize individuals who have had a lasting impact on their own communities, our nation, and our world."

Zentangle and NECO teamed up and, with the 2008 Medal of Honor winners' help, we all created this beautiful and powerful Zentangle mosaic which was incorporated into this poster.

NECO poster

Leaders in art, science, law, national defense, education, philanthropy, industry, sports, medicine, and government drew these Zentangles. Who did which one? A U.S. Senator? An Olympic gold-medalist? A retired judge? Maybe a six-year-old daughter of a well-known philanthropist? The owner of a major sports team? Where is he from? What language does she speak? Without knowing, we can still appreciate this marvelous mosaic as we simultaneously honor each tile's individual and unique contribution.

We are grateful to NECO, the 2008 Ellis Island Medal of Honor recipients and family members who "one stroke at a time" contributed to this powerful image. This mosaic inspires us to honor the beauty of each person's pattern and unique perspective and appreciate and celebrate how each individual combines and collaborates in a larger American mosaic.
